Three arrested with red panda hides in Banke



BANKE: Police have arrested three people from a hotel at Chappergauri in Kohalpur Municipality-12 of Banke with two hides of red panda.

The arrested are Dal Bahadur Shahi, 40, of Bheriganga Municipality-10 of Surkhet, Dhan Bahadur Shahi, 42, of Junichandi Rural Municipality-11 of Jajarkot and Bharat Bahadur, 33, of Kupindedaha Municipality-4 of Salyan.

A joint police team from Lumbini Province Police Office and Area Police Office, Kohalpur found them in room 113 of the hotel and arrested them along with hides hidden in a bag.

They have been sent to Banke National Park Office for further investigation and action, according to the District Police Office, Banke.
